How V Way Taxi Supports Drivers


In the dynamic world of ride-hailing services, companies like V Way Taxi have been pivotal in providing flexible earning opportunities to drivers. V Way Taxi goes the extra mile to support its drivers in various ways, ensuring a mutually beneficial partnership. Here's a closer look at how V Way Taxi supports its drivers.

1. Fair Earnings and Transparent Pricing:
V Way Taxi ensures that drivers receive a fair share of the earnings from each ride. The company maintains transparent pricing policies, allowing drivers to understand how their earnings are calculated. This transparency builds trust and empowers drivers to make informed decisions.

2. Flexible Working Hours:
One of the key advantages of driving for V Way Taxi is the flexibility it offers. Drivers can choose when they want to work, enabling them to balance their driving gig with other commitments and responsibilities.

3. Driver Incentive Programs:
V Way Taxi motivates drivers by implementing various incentive programs. These programs reward drivers for meeting specific targets such as completing a certain number of rides within a timeframe or maintaining high passenger ratings. Incentives can include bonuses, higher earnings per ride, or other perks.

4. Driver Support and Training:
V Way Taxi invests in providing comprehensive support and training for its drivers. This includes guidance on best practices, customer service, and navigation tips. Regular training sessions help drivers enhance their skills and provide a better experience for passengers.

5. Safety Measures:
Driver safety is a top priority for V Way Taxi. The company implements safety features within its app, including an emergency assistance button and real-time tracking. This not only safeguards drivers but also reassures them while on the road.

6. Accessible Technology:
V Way Taxi's user-friendly app makes it easy for drivers to manage their rides, track earnings, and receive ride requests. The app's intuitive design ensures that even drivers with varying levels of tech-savviness can navigate it effectively.

7. Community and Networking:
V Way Taxi fosters a sense of community among its drivers. The company may organize driver meetups, online forums, or social events, allowing drivers to connect, share experiences, and learn from one another.

8. Diverse Earning Opportunities:
Aside from standard ride-hailing, V Way Taxi might offer drivers opportunities to participate in other services like food delivery or package delivery. This diversity of services can help drivers maximize their earnings potential.
